  3. .DS_Store -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/.DS_Store

    In the macOS operating system, .DS_Store is a file that stores custom attributes of its containing folder, such as folder view options, icon positions, and other visual information. [ 1 ] The name is an abbreviation of Desktop Services Store, [ 2 ] reflecting its purpose. It is created and maintained by the Finder application in every folder ...

  6. Files (Google)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Files_(Google)

    Android. Available in. 90 languages. Website. files.google.com. Files (formerly known as Files Go) is a file management app developed by Google for file browsing, media consumption, storage clean-up and offline file transfer. It was released by Google on December 5, 2017 [3] with a custom version for China being released on May 30, 2018.
